Home Page

Meadowhead Junior School

High Aspirations Bright Future


1001 Inventions and the Library of Secrets.

Find out about some of the inventions from The House of Wisdom by watching this short film clip.

House of Wisdom

Find out more about the House of Wisdom by watching this short video clip - this clip accompanies Lesson 2.

Lesson 2: Animation of Al-Jazari's Elephant Clock.

Watch this short clip about Al-Jazari's Elephant Clock which show you how it worked.

Baghdad in 900AD, the golden age of Islam - Lost Lands

Learn a little about what life in Baghdad AD 900 was like with Ali and help him try to solve a riddle.

Find out how Houses looked in Baghdad 900AD.

An ancient Islamic nomad is giving up his camel-hair tent and has designed his own 'forever' family home to settle in Baghdad.

Find out about the food eaten in Baghdad 900AD in this clip.

This cooking show parody introduces you to early Islamic food. A-Razi prepares goat stew, Ahmed makes a fish dish drink and Aisha uses traditional flavours to enhance her lamb stew!

Invention & Innovation in Baghdad 900AD.

Through this popular reality TV parody, gain an insight into early Islamic inventions. A little bit like Dragon's Den BUT the inventions are all from The Golden Age.

1001 Inventions and the World of Ibn Al Haytham.

Watch this short film from '1001 Inventions and the World of Ibn Al-Haytham'. Ibn Al-Haytham was a famous mathematician, physicist and astronomer and is referred to as the Father of modern optics.